It will be the UK's third biggest arena A new arena and leisure complex with a 17,000 capacity has been given the go-ahead to be built in Bristol.

It was announced yesterday (April 8) that Communities Secretary Robert Jenrick approved plans for the major venue which will be built on the Bristol-South Gloucestershire border on the former Filton Airfield.
